Output ec91c88c73969588b75c2f830e4aa67ceadca76bf48559400becbfd4f6cb760e:96

value
93253
script pubkey
OP_0 OP_PUSHBYTES_20 121df5e68ed8ae3ac4d5e7645de1ec39e75af7e0
address
bc1qzgwlte5wmzhr43x4uaj9mc0v88n44alqapd5qd
transaction
ec91c88c73969588b75c2f830e4aa67ceadca76bf48559400becbfd4f6cb760e
spent
true